The Art for Joy's Sake Journal

The Art for Joy's Sake Journal PDF Author: Kristy Rice
Publisher: Artisan
ISBN: 9780764357671
Category : Art
Languages : en
Pages : 60

Get Book Here

Book Description
These beautiful pages invite you to pick up your brush and grow. Kristy Rice's joy-focused approach to watercolor art has won the hearts of fans worldwide, and with this journal Rice offers ways for all levels of painters to make "art for joy's sake" and simultaneously paint a personal keepsake or add beauty to your inspiration wall. Includes 10 illustrations ready to be watercolored on thick, textured paper, alongside full-color tear out reproductions of the same works painted by Kristy herself, demonstrating palette choices and brushwork. Enrich your art with "prompt" ideas to inspire your painting's growth; pages with no-stress exercises for techniques; inspirational artwork and quotations; and even a few recipes for nourishing your body along with your spirit! Each item in the Artisan series is designed to offer a specially crafted watercolor discovery glowing with Kristy Rice's creative touch. Also in the series: Watercolor Cards: Kristy Rice Designs.

The Joy of Art

The Joy of Art PDF Author: Carolyn Schlam
Publisher: Simon and Schuster
ISBN: 1621537056
Category : Art
Languages : en
Pages : 352

Get Book Here

Book Description
An Artist’s Insights on Art Appreciation Written by a practicing artist, this book decodes and maps the basic elements of visual art, leading the reader to a greater understanding and appreciation. Not an art history lesson per se, this illustrated guide is rather a tool kit to make the study of art and a visit to the museum truly rewarding. An entertaining and informative read, The Joy of Art offers the reader: A working art vocabulary to help you identify and explain what you’re looking at Answers to many of the questions you may have about visual art in general A summary of the basic criteria to consider when looking at art Highlights of the primary art genres and an introduction to the artists who pursued them Many visual examples of aesthetic considerations and practices Interesting facts about your favorite artists and clues to why they made the choices they did A few games to test your new skills The Joy of Art contains 150 color photographs and many interesting insights from an artist-author who takes readers behind the curtain and into the studio to uncover what actually goes into making a work of art. If you love art, this book will take your appreciation to a new level. Not only will your enjoyment of art increase, you’ll be able to clearly communicate your understanding to others.

Simple Joys: The American Folk Art of Jane Wooster Scott

Simple Joys: The American Folk Art of Jane Wooster Scott PDF Author: Jane Wooster Scott
Publisher: Running Press
ISBN: 9780762426713
Category : Art
Languages : en
Pages : 176

Get Book Here

Book Description
Jane Wooster Scott's paintings celebrate American ideals from a simpler time. Featuring charming depictions of everyday scenes from the turn of the twentieth century, this collection includes a Sunday in New England, Autumn Hayride, and Quilts of Cape Cod, as well as quotes from famous Americans on the simple truths for leading a happy, rewarding life.

Visions from the Upside Down

Visions from the Upside Down PDF Author:
Publisher: Random House
ISBN: 1473577829
Category : Art
Languages : en
Pages : 242

Get Book Here

Book Description
Over 200 artists present their own unique visions of Stranger Things in a stunning, full-color celebration of the runaway hit Netflix series. In honor of Stranger Things, the innovative pop culture enthusiasts at Printed In Bloodare proud to present the latest release in their ongoing series of artbooks. More than two hundred artists, drawn from the earthly dimensions of comics, illustration, fine art, videogames, and animation, have come together to bring us a unique vision of the world of Hawkins, Indiana. Come dig into this collection of more than two hundred brand-new images and see what new worlds you might discover lurking just beneath the surface. My Art Book of Happiness

My Art Book of Happiness PDF Author: Shana Gozansky
Publisher: Phaidon Press
ISBN: 9781838660826
Category : Juvenile Nonfiction
Languages : en
Pages : 0

Get Book Here

Book Description
The third in an introductory series to fine art curated by theme for young children Emotions are part of every toddler's day... and now, part of their first art collection! 35 full-page artworks from a variety of periods introduce emotions through one of the most important feelings of all - happiness. Each image is accompanied by a brief, tender, read-aloud text, and the work's title and artist's name are included as secondary material for true integration of narrative and information. It's a perfect introduction to this wonderful emotion for families of all kinds. Ages 2-4

The Art of the National Parks (Fifty-Nine Parks)

The Art of the National Parks (Fifty-Nine Parks) PDF Author: Weldon Owen
Publisher: Simon and Schuster
ISBN: 1647223709
Category : Art
Languages : en
Pages : 89

Get Book Here

Book Description
"Fifty-Nine Parks collaborated with some of the world's foremost contemporary artists and designers to create original posters that celebrate the unique beauty of the U.S. National Park system. Each poster is a contemporary take on the W.P.A. posters of the 1930s, resulting in a one-of-a-kind tribute to the majesty of the national parks"--
